摘 要:目的:探讨NCIS、TRIPS、SNAP-Ⅱ和SNAPPE-Ⅱ评分法对新生儿危重症预测的准确性及评估的优越性。方法:收集2015年本院新生儿重症监护室的临床资料进行前瞻性研究,比较4种评分法在对死亡、Ⅲ度颅内出血、中重度HIE、机械通气、败血症、用氧时间>21 d、喂养不耐受>7 d、住院时间>28 d、3次输血治疗等9种新生儿危重症发生率预测的准确性及评估优越性方面的价值。结果:480例新生儿纳入研究。H-L拟合度检验示4种评分模型均有较好的拟合度(P>0.05),P值分别为0.53、0.68、0.92、0.94。分别分析发生9种危重症时,4种评分法的受试者工作特征曲线下面积(AUC)均>0.5;其中对死亡、中重度HIE、机械通气预测的准确性较高,AUC均>0.8。TRIPS和SNAPPE-Ⅱ预测上述3种新生儿危重症的准确性最高。结论:TRIPS和SNAPPE-Ⅱ有较高的新生儿死亡、中重度HIE、机械通气的预测准确性,可以在临床中应用。TRIPS评分简单,可快速取得,可在基层医院推广使用。Objective To explore the accuracy and superiority of NCIS,TRIPS,SNAP-Ⅱ and SNAPPE-Ⅱ in predicting neonatal critical illness. Methods The clinical data of patients in neonatal intensive care unit were collected in our hospital in 2015. The accuracy and superiority of the above 4 scoring methods on predicting the incidences of 9 kinds of neonatal critical illness,including death,degree Ⅲ intracranial hemorrhages,moderate to severe HIE,mechanical ventilation,sepsis,using oxygen time 〉21 d,feeding intolerance 〉7 d,length of stay 〉28 d,undergoing three times of blood transfusion treatment were compared. Results Total 480 neonates were enrolled in this study. H-L fit test showed that the four scoring methodes had good fitting degree( P〉0.05),the value of P was 0.53,0.68,0.92,0.94,respectively. Area under the working characteristic curve( AUC) of the subjects was all 〉 0. 5 by the 4 scoring methods. The accuracy of predicting death,moderate or severe HIE and mechanical ventilation was high,the AUC were all 〉 0. 8. TRIPS and SNAPPE-Ⅱ were the most accurate predictors of these three neonatal critical illnesses. Conclusion The accuracy of TRIPS and SNAPPE-Ⅱ in predicting neonatal mortality,moderate or severe HIE and mechanical ventilation were higher,which could be used in clinical. TRIPS scoring method was simple and quick,which could be use widely in basic hospital.
